Atlantic salmon (Salmo salar L.) aquaculture production in Maine is a valuable contributor to the economy, the expansion of which has been challenged by the parasitic salmon louse Lepeophtheirus salmonis. As planktonic organisms, the life of the salmon louse is primarily dictated by the physical conditions of the environment: the temperature for development time, salinity for survival, and current velocity for transport. Salmon lice are obligate parasites for whom the successful infection of a suitable host is critical to completion of their life cycle. Fish production from aquaculture has continued to grow over the past several decades, with finfishes being fed formulated, fish meal-based diets supporting most of that industry’s growth. However, increased demand and costs, coupled with static volume and erratic supplies of fish meal, has resulted in the use of alternative plant-derived protein sources. A common oilseed protein source is soybean meal (SBM), because of its protein content and amino acid profile; however, it also contains multiple anti-nutritional factors, including phytoestrogens. Since the 1980s, non-algal aquaculture has grown to encompass 49% of all seafood production in response to a growing human population and increased seafood demand (FAO, 2022). Hurdles exist to aquaculture sustainability, including dependence on wild sourced fishmeal (FM) and the impacts wastewater discharge. It takes 4-5 tons of wild forage fish to produce one ton of dry FM (Miles and Chapman, 2006) and as aquaculture is primarily conducted in earthen ponds and public open water bodies (FAO, 2022), finfish culture can have a high impact on the surrounding environment by discharging excess nutrients. Harmful algal blooms (HABs) result from outbreaks of any of several different species of toxin-producing phytoplankton and that can have major detrimental effects on marine ecosystems and pose severe health and economic threats to human communities. Of particular concern along the United States West Coast are HABs of pennate diatom genus Pseudo-nitzschia that produce the potent neurotoxin domoic acid (DA). The coastal ocean between Cape Mendocino, CA, and Cape Blanco, OR is a hotspot for Pseudo-nitzschia spp. HABs. Aquaculture is a large part of the food production sector which is greatly expanding. One of the largest losses in aquaculture is due to pathogens. Current solutions for protecting farmed finfish from pathogens can be very expensive with variable efficiency. Current disease prevention strategies include vaccination. Types of vaccines include immersion vaccines, feed vaccines, and injectable vaccines. The most popular solution is oil-based injectable vaccines due to its protection. However, the oil-based adjuvant used in most of these formulations causes adverse reactions in the fish including reduced growth. I examined the effects of temperature (25, 30, and 35°C) on growth, standard metabolic rate (SMR), and lower dissolved oxygen tolerance (LDOT) of juvenile Speckled Peacock Bass Cichla temensis. Fish were acclimated to 150-L aquaria for 7 weeks before the growth, SMR, and LDOT experiments. The growth study lasted 58 days and fish acclimated to 25 and 30°C displayed similar growth rates, while fish acclimated to 35°C had very poor growth rates. The obligate parasitic dinoflagellate Amyloodinium ocellatum causes amyloodiniosis in warm water marine fishes. The prolific parasite, which has a direct, three-stage life cycle, is highly infectious and can cause heavy losses in aquaculture. Prevention, biosecurity, and early detection are vital for control. In this work, microscopy and a loop-mediated isothermal amplification (LAMP) assay were compared for early diagnosis of A. ocellatum in cultured stocks, and the freeze tolerance of tomonts was assessed to determine if frozen wild fish used as fish food can serve as a potential vector for the parasite.

Aquaculture is vital for the global food supply, but the high incidence of infectious diseases threatens the industry’s productivity. The intestinal mucosa is a key port of entry for pathogens and provides an extensive interface for host-microbe interactions. Tight junctions are at the core of gut barrier function and the mucosal health of finfish. Disruption of these complexes gives rise to sepsis, which leads to systemic inflammation and death. Culture models and facilities for large-scale, commercial production of popular Gulf of Mexico species are unavailable. The spotted seatrout (Cynoscion nebulosus) is one of the most popular recreational fishes in the Gulf of Mexico. Seatrout culture techniques were adapted from red drum (Sciaenops ocellatus) protocols developed in the 1970s. Broodstock husbandry, spawning, and extensive pond rearing techniques using fertilized and bloomed brackish ponds were well-established by the 1980s.
